Keyboard shortcuts for WMP 11 in XP Home
When viewing an AVI in full screen mode I can't get the correct keyboard
shortcuts to work. For example, I can use [SHIFT]+[LEFT ARROW] to make micro moves backwards/rewind but according to WMP 11 Help file, the "Rewind Video" shortcut is "CTRL+SHIFT+B" - why is this different? I am also using a Microsoft Digital Media Keyboard model 1031 with driver 5.1.2600.2180. Thanks. |

Keyboard shortcuts for WMP 11 in XP Home
Current microsoft keyboard drivers should be found in "Human Interface
Devices",in hardware.Human interface section should now give you the key- board properties & driver,the keyboard will still have its own properties section also.Microsoft changed the keyboard & mouse field a few years ago,w/o the human interface section in device mgr,youre drivers would currently be at 2001.Try updating the drivers/software,you can get the latest download at: http://www.microsoft.com/hardware/do...px?category=MK "dymandave" wrote: When viewing an AVI in full screen mode I can't get the correct keyboard shortcuts to work.
